how much did the insanity dvds cost?

I actually got it for free off my sister because she bought it when it first came out, and she didn't get a chance to do it because she got pregnant. But I think the cost was about $150ish? Because it's three payments of 39.95 and shipping and handling which is about $30. It's a ton of money to dish out on a workout, I'm glad she passed it on to me for free.

I'm doing it.

I've got deluxe.

WORTH EVERY SINGLE CENT!!

But only if you've got the balls to stick with it. This is more tough then anything P90x and Chalean Extreme ever did! I thought Plyo X was hard, but gaawwddd. The warm up is tough, the workout is harder. For the first week, 10 minutes before the workout was done I felt like I was going to toss my cookies!

If you are out of shape, this isn't your gig.

I'm on day 18. :) I have not taken my measurements again, but I recently took another shot to add to my "before" collection, and the results are there. I've never felt so toned and strong, even though I am heavier then 137. Even at 137, I never looked this sexy.

Shaun T was suprisingly not annoying at all. I didn't like him in HHA and thought he was waaaayyy too arrogant, and when I first heard of this program, I thought it was full of crap. Now that I'm doing it, I'm glad I gave it a chance.

 Despite the intensity, these videos are fun as hell and always quick paced. Unlike Chalene's and Tony's tendecy to be like "oh you can take it down a notch" or chit-chatting during the workout. Naw. Shaun is "YOU can do this. Do it. Get it done. Dig deeper. Gogogo" there is barely any chit chat. It's awesome. Funfunfun~!!
